Understanding Inpatient Rehabilitation: Advantages and Considerations



When you pick inpatient rehab for addiction treatment, you're going with an immersive experience that can considerably boost your recuperation.

This organized environment removes you from everyday disturbances and activates, enabling you to focus entirely on healing. You'll gain from 24/7 support from experienced specialists who can resolve your needs and supply individualized care.

The thorough treatment often consists of therapy sessions, group activities, and instructional workshops, fostering a sense of area amongst peers.

Additionally, remaining in a safe space helps you establish necessary coping approaches and life abilities. While the commitment is extreme, the environment assists in a much deeper understanding of your addiction, setting a strong structure for long-term sobriety.

Inpatient rehabilitation can be a transformative step towards recuperation.

Exploring Outpatient Rehab: Adaptability and Support



After taking into consideration the immersive experience of inpatient rehabilitation, you may find outpatient rehabilitation appealing for its versatility and support.



This option enables you to proceed your daily life while getting treatment, which can be critical if you have work or family commitments. You'll go to therapy sessions, support groups, and individually therapy, all while keeping your normal routine.

This balance can help you use what you learn in real-time, strengthening your recovery. And also, outpatient programs often provide a solid network of assistance, attaching you with peers who understand your journey.

Having that encouragement can make a significant distinction. If you're seeking a technique that adapts to your way of living while offering vital assistance, outpatient rehab may simply be the appropriate fit for you.

Secret Aspects to Consider When Picking a Treatment Option



How do you determine the very best therapy choice for your recuperation? Begin by analyzing your addiction seriousness. If you're encountering severe compound usage, inpatient rehab may be needed.

Consider your everyday responsibilities as well; outpatient therapy offers adaptability if you can't take some time off work or family members commitments.

Think about your support group. Do you have close friends or family members who can help during your recovery? Their involvement can significantly boost outpatient success.

Additionally, assess the types of therapies used at each center. Some might offer specialized treatments that reverberate with your requirements.

Finally, your budget plays a role. Confirm insurance coverage and inquire about layaway plan. Evaluating these elements will certainly lead you towards the best option for your trip.
